What is a custom crush service and does Division Winemaking Company offer it?
Custom crush is a service where a winery uses its equipment and expertise to help you produce your own wine from purchased grapes or juice. It's popular among enthusiasts who want to create a personal label, and it's worth calling (503) 877-8755 to ask if this is something Division Winemaking Company currently offers.

What wine regions does Division Winemaking Company source fruit from?
Portland-based wineries commonly source grapes from Willamette Valley AVAs like Chehalem Mountains or Eola-Amity Hills, though some producers reach into the Columbia Valley or Walla Walla as well. Contacting the winery directly will give you the most accurate picture of their current sourcing.
